Trials rider Abel Mustieles has signed contract with Monty Bicycles to be a Monty rider during the next seasons. The agreement was signed
in our factory, located in Sant Feliu de Llobregat.
Abel Mustieles will participate in both Uci and Biketrial championships, always riding the new M5. In addition, due to this agreement, Monty now has confindence in their 20" category, and Mustieles will be the perfect 20" and M5 ambassador around the world.
Although only being 20 years old, Abel Mustieles is already winnning international competitions in Elite category, and is a worldwide reference as a rider. Once more, Monty reinforces his competition team, which is the world´s most triumphant of history, and also thinks about championships as being a platform to test new products and showcasing their bikes.

I´ll explain this factual error in chrome´s translation: In spanish, trials riders (and ONLY trials riders, not BMX neither cycling nor MTB) are known as "piloto de biketrial" (biketrial rider). The word "piloto" means F1, or rally driver, or airplane pilot. I hate this name for trials riders, due to the fact that it is only used in relation to trials when trials riders are speaking. No one who doesn´t know trials will ever think about naming a trials rider a "piloto", it´s a bit stupid.
So yes, if you ever meet a spanish who does not know trials and tell him: Abel Mustieles es un piloto de Koxx(Abel Mustieles is a Koxx rider), he will probably think Koxx is a new f**king F1 team or an airline...
